AceShowbiz - Machine Gun Kelly has premiered a music video to support his single "Invincible", which features Ester Dean. The clip itself is loaded with a host of dramatic scenes, including those which see a girl dealing with an unplanned pregnancy, a crowd of youngsters getting involved in a neighborhood brawl, and two kids stealing a cop car.

"As my world turns, the heart beats/Not only in my chest, but the heart in the streets," so the Cleveland native raps. Dean, meanwhile, provides a powerful hook as she sings, "I hear voices in the air/I hear it loud and clear/The're telling me to listen/ Nothing can compare/I just want to listen/Telling me/I'm invincible."

The music video is directed by Issac Rentz, while the song itself is lifted from MGK's forthcoming album "Lace Up". The single, which is produced by Alex Da Kid, also serves as the official theme song for WWE's Wrestlemania 28 and has been licensed for 2012 NFL Thursday Night Football.
